Which ethical principle emphasizes respect for patients’ rights and autonomy?

The principle that emphasizes respect for patients’ rights and autonomy is autonomy itself. This ethical principle highlights the importance of recognizing and upholding an individual's right to make informed decisions about their own healthcare. In the context of chiropractic practice, this means that practitioners are required to respect a patient’s choices, provide all necessary information for informed consent, and support their ability to lead their own treatment journey. Autonomy fosters an environment of trust and collaboration between the chiropractor and the patient, ensuring that the care provided aligns with the patient’s values and preferences. This principle underlines the foundation of patient-centered care, which is pivotal in all health-related professions.
